[Act XIII – Sempronio and Pármeno are Executed for the Murder of Celestina]
-
Description
-
After Sosia informs Tristan that Sempronio and Pármeno are dead, they go and wake Calisto to inform him of the news. Sosia tells him that they have been decapitated by the executioner on the order of the justice (the ‘alguacil’). Calisto is struck with grief, and he asks Sosia to tell him the reason for their execution. Sosia explains that they were guilty of murdering Celestina because she would not share the gold chain that Calisto had given her. This image depicts the decapitation scene. Pármeno appears to have been beheaded first (his head is in the bottom right corner), while Sempronio is on his knees awaiting his fate. The executioner has his right hand placed on Sempronio’s head, and his sword is drawn upward in his left hand. Something odd is happening around the executioner's waist, making it appear connected to the background (likely through a printing/engraving error). There are three figures to the right of the image, perhaps the alguacil’s men (although one of them may be Sosia). One is riding a horse, and another is standing with a spear of some sort in his right hand. The central of these three figures is odd, since everything below his collarbone appears to be missing (also likely through a printing/engraving error). These three figures are all wearing hats. Immediately behind the executioner we see what appears to be gallows, and to the left of this we see buildings.
